[Jake.]

Mam was nagging me and I wanted it to stop. It was so nice in bed.

“I don’t want to go to school.”

[JAKE]

Jesus, there was no need to shout. I struggled to open my eyes. My eyelids wouldn’t move and they hurt. I remembered I was a wizard and investigated. Then I started healing them.

[JAKE]

“Give me a minute, Fluffy. My eyelids are burnt.”

[Glad you are awake… and calling me Fluffy again. I’ve missed that.]

‘And done.’ I was getting better at this healing thing. I opened my eyes and looked at my dragon. He looked fine except for his eyes. They were white where they weren’t bloody.

Running to his side I put my hands on his beautiful face. Using tendrils of magic I assessed the situation and was horrified by the extent of the damage. I tried to get his cells to regenerate, but some of them were dead and far beyond my powers to heal.

[You saved my life. Never think I am not grateful for that.]

Putting a stasis field over his eyes I tried to think.

[We underestimated the Progenitors. They must not only be able to detect dragons in glim, but also be capable of attacking us.]

“I’m getting Urda. She’s much better at healing than I am.”

[I fear the damage is too great, but I can still see in the magical planes. I shall survive.]

I patted my dragon on the neck and hopped for Salice.
